i have a 96 blazer (mid-year) with a random misfire that started Sunday evening. I have replaced the cap and rotor didn't work.check the cam sensor and the coil tested fine. fuel pressure was 58 psi not for sure if that is too low not. I would like to know more of the main causes and how to check them, please! already have fuel injector cleaner add to the fuel did that when it started. plugs and wires not even a year old yet.
